1.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is Verbal Irony?
Back
A figure of speech where the speaker says one thing but means another, often the opposite.
2.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is Situational Irony?
Back
A situation where the outcome is significantly different from what was expected.
3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is Dramatic Irony?
Back
A literary device where the audience knows more about a situation than the characters do.
4.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is Onomatopoeia?
Back
A literary device that uses words that imitate the sound they describe, like 'buzz' or 'sizzle'.
5.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is a Theme in literature?
Back
A unifying idea that is a recurrent element in a literary work.
6.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is Allusion?
Back
A brief and indirect reference to a person, place, thing, or idea of historical, cultural, literary or political significance.
7.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is a Symbol?
Back
An object that represents or stands for an idea, belief, or action.
